Customizing fax settings
Changing the fax resolution
Settings range from Standard (fastest speed) to Super Fine (slowest speed but best quality).
1
Load an original document faceup, short edge first into the ADF or facedown on the scanner glass.
Note: Do not load postcards, photos, small items, transparencies, photo paper, or thin media (such as magazine
clippings) into the ADF. Place these items on the scanner glass.

2
If you are loading a document into the ADF, then adjust the paper guides.
3
From the home screen, navigate to:
Fax > enter the fax number > Options
4
From the Resolution area, touch the arrows to change to the resolution you want.
5
Touch Fax It.
Making a fax lighter or darker
1
Load an original document faceup, short edge first into the ADF or facedown on the scanner glass.
Note: Do not load postcards, photos, small items, transparencies, photo paper, or thin media (such as magazine
clippings) into the ADF. Place these items on the scanner glass.

2
If you are loading a document into the ADF, then adjust the paper guides.
3
From the home screen, navigate to:
Fax > enter the fax number > Options
4
From the Darkness area, touch the arrows to adjust the darkness of the fax.
5
Touch Fax It.
